About the Team

The Operations Division at College Board is focused on leading the organization’s transformation to support delivery of digital assessments. The division aims to provide strong customer engagement and world-class digital assessment delivery experience that supports millions of students and thousands of schools and test centers annually. The 55-person Customer Engagement department is a combination of teams that supports our key constituents: students, parents, educators, and our state partners that represent approximately 2 million contacts per year.This integrated team serves as the organization’s ‘front line’ and represents the voice of the customer, partnering across the organization to help improve the overall customer experience.  

About the Opportunity 

As the Services for Students with Disabilities (SSD) Customer Care Assistant Director, you will apply your superior case management skills and proactive outreach in support of a mission-critical operational function. You will be responsible for managing escalated cases, email responses, and certain SSD-specific procedures. You will ensure that these cases are resolved within the specified guidelines and policies of the SSD Program. You understand the importance of asking probing questions to pinpoint a customer's needs and for guiding customers to the policies and resources needed to resolve their questions and challenges.  

The SSD Customer Care team handles College Board’s escalations for students with disabilities.This group of students, parents, and educators comprise a group that presents sensitive, nuanced, and complex issues for resolution. This team will deliver high quality customer service across all College Board programs.The SSD Customer Care Assistant Director temporarily reports to the Senior Director, Operational Effectiveness but will ultimately report directly to the Director, SSD Customer Care.

College Board is a mission-driven not-for-profit organization that connects students to college success and opportunity. Founded in 1900, College Board was created to expand access to higher education. Today, the membership association is made up of over 6,000 of the world’s leading educational institutions and is dedicated to promoting excellence and equity in education. Each year, College Board helps more than seven million students prepare for a successful transition to college through programs and services in college readiness and college success—including the SAT, the Advanced Placement Program, and BigFuture. The organization also serves the education community through research and advocacy on behalf of students, educators, and schools.
